Thiel Athletics Hall of Fame
One of the most decorated wrestlers in the storied history of Thiel Wrestling, Corey Brown is the only four-time NCAA All-American in program history, earning national honors at 133 pounds in 2009 (sixth), 2010 (eighth), 2011 (eighth) and 2012 (eighth). He also excelled in the classroom, receiving National Wrestliang Coaches Assocation (NWCA) Scholar All-America recognition three times from 2010-12. Dominating the Presidents' Athletic Conference (PAC) throughout his career, he captured four consecutive conference championships from 2009-12.
By the conclusion of his career, Brown amassed 109 victories, the fifth-most in program history. His sustained success on both the conference and national stages established him as one of the greatest wrestlers ever to compete for the Tomcats, combining championship performances, academic excellence and unmatched consistency over four outstanding seasons.
